Definitely Radicale
We have separate calendars (ie we individually sync between our phones and other devices) plus joint calendars that we also sync…
On Android I use davx to sync and Fossify Calendar which allows me to see multiple calendars but only sounds reminders for my personal & joint appointments, not others.
On my laptops I’m currently usong Vivaldi’s built-in calendar and that’s working well for me.
How did you do joint calendars in Radicale?
It’s just another calendar…
So, we have:
Me
Them
Us
House Stuff
(ie bin day reminders)- I use this for Home Assistant
Birthdays
- I don’t recall at the moment, but an app used this for contact’s birthdays…
I then setup DavX to sync to
Me
andUs
on my phone andThem
andUs
on their phone.In Fossify Calendar it’s really easy to show /hide separate calendars as well as selecting the correct calendar when adding / editing events.

I recently switched from radicale to baikal. Both are straight forward no frills caldav / carddav managers. Baikal has a more modern UX. My switch came from choosing to use YunoHost to simplify my home server management
